About the Shimoga
Shimoga, also known as Shivamogga, is a picturesque city in the state of Karnataka, India. Nestled amidst lush greenery and scenic landscapes, it serves as a gateway to the Western Ghats. The city is known for its rich cultural heritage, historical significance, and natural beauty, making it a popular destination for tourists seeking both adventure and tranquility.

How to Reach Shimoga
Air
The nearest airport is Mangalore International Airport, approximately 180 km away.;
Bus
Frequent bus services are available from nearby cities like Bangalore and Mangalore.
Train
Shimoga has a railway station with regular trains connecting to major cities.
